Ticket: Intermittent connection failures on Splitwing, our A/B assignment service. Since Tuesday, roughly 2% of assignment calls time out during the variant lookup, and affected clients fall back to control. Pool exhaustion on the assignments replica is the likely cause; the Corvale dashboard shows saturation spikes at the top of each hour. Support can reproduce by hammering the assign endpoint during those windows. To test connectivity directly, use the replica connection string below.

primary connection of yagep-kahip = redis://giliel_svc:zYiKsLL2PLpfPL@db-348f.xolmarsys.corp:5432/fenwyn

Subject: Q3 Budget Request — Field Enablement

Team,

I'm requesting an additional 140K for the Harvell Dynamics field enablement program. Sales leads in the Norwick and Tellbrook regions have flagged tooling gaps that are slowing deal cycles. The spend covers licenses, two contract trainers, and travel. Full breakdown is attached for Friday's review. The rationale ties directly to the plans below.

management briefing: Project Ulavan slips by two quarters because of the staffing delay.

Ticket: Staging env misconfigured for Siftgate bloom filter

The bloom layer in front of the Pellet KV store is rejecting all lookups in staging because the env file was copied from the dev template without credentials. False-positive tuning values are fine; only the auth line is missing. To unblock the weekly demo, the Pellet admission secret must be set on the following line.

env line for yaguf-fajop: LEDGER_TOKEN13=fb08984397349